Rheinmetall, a leader in defence and security technologies and VRAI, a simulation data company, have announced a partnership in the area of simulation data & AI. This cooperation aims to unlock the power of data driven insights to improve armor crew performance, and to build the large datasets that will enable AI tools to support armor crews, crucial for the modern operating environment.

VRAI’s mission is to redefine exceptional human performance, and believe that the data generated in simulators is an untapped resource that can be used to transform how people train.

VRAI are niche leaders in simulation data, providing human performance data products to their customers, delivering data driven insights that reduce the cost and time to train personnel, while improving crew performance.

The partnership with Rheinmetall is recognition of the innovative data solutions VRAI can offer to Rheinmetall, and how Rheinmetall are driving innovation in the training and simulation space for their customers.

Rheinmetall and VRAI signed their new agreement at the world's largest simulation & training conference, I/ITSEC, in Orlando’s Orange County Convention Centre in Florida this week. Commenting on the new partnership, Bartek Panasewicz, VP Training Systems Land at Rheinmetall said:

“In my opinion, this partnership demonstrates our ability to be a systems integrator, consistently combining best-in-class technologies to develop turnkey solutions for our customers. The partnership with VRAI has been very beneficial so far, and we look forward to continuing our collaboration. We’re seeing a huge increase in demand for AI enhanced training data assessment.”

Rheinmetall & VRAI will collaborate around VRAI’s HEAT simulation data solution to offer insights into what drives armor crew performance, starting initially with the XR Driving Simulator, with the potential to expand from there to other armor vehicle simulation solutions.

Commenting on this partnership, Pat O’Connor, VRAI’s CEO said:

“I believe that this collaboration with Rheinmetall is a great example of how niche technology companies like VRAI can partner with some of the biggest and best defence and security companies in Europe to deliver outstanding solutions to our customers. We believe that the data generated in simulation can not only drive insight into performance, but is also critical to our customers ability to build AI enabled support tools for their end users.”



ree


Rheinmetall and VRAI are also collaborating through the EU’s European Defence Fund project FEDERATES, developing an European Modelling and Simulation solution for Distributed Synthetic Training and decision-making, to support member states achieve and maintain forces' readiness in the EU.


About Rheinmetall

Based in Düsseldorf, Rheinmetall AG is an internationally operating technology corporation. Founded in 1889, the company is a leading systems supplier for the defence industry and, at the same time, a driver of forward-looking technological and industrial innovations in civil markets. With around 40,000 employees at 174 sites worldwide, the company, listed on the DAX40 since March 2023, generated sales of €9.8bn in the 2024 business year.

Rheinmetall Electronics supplies mission equipment as well as training solutions to armed forces, government agencies and civil customers. The company offers a comprehensive range of products and services for armed forces, civil security forces and industry partners. In close cooperation with the customer, Rheinmetall Electronics designs, develops and produces high-end products and integrates complex system solutions.

As systems become ever more complex, the armed forces expect cost-effective training solutions throughout the entire lifecycle of the original systems. Rheinmetall offers tailored solutions for the target-oriented training of soldiers, ranging from fundamental e-learning to sophisticated simulators and complex training centres.

About VRAI


VRAI’s mission is to redefine exceptional human performance through data driven simulation. They aim to unlock every individual's full potential in order to help save lives. VRAI are working with some of the leading European aerospace and defence companies, as well as working directly to a number of European MOD’s, and at the forefront of simulation related R&D in defence and security globally.

VRAI are HQ’d in Dublin, Ireland, with their UK company based out of Newcastle, and recently opened their US office in Orlando’s simulation and training cluster based around University of Central Florida.
